Kingdom Hearts 3 is getting its own limited edition PlayStation 4 Pro on the same day the game hits North America. Sony Interactive Entertainment and Square Enix will release the limited-edition hardware, which comes bundled with a copy of Kingdom Hearts 3, on Jan. 29 for $399.99.
The PS4 Pro comes with a 1 TB hard drive and design elements from the Kingdom Hearts series. The system also includes a matching DualShock 4 controller with decorations on the touchpad and around the D-pad.

The limited edition Kingdom Hearts 3 PS4 Pro bundle is a GameStop/EB Games exclusive in the U.S. and Canada.
Kingdom Hearts 3 is coming to PS4 and Xbox One on Jan. 29. Our most recent look at the game showcased its opening movie and new music from Hikaru Utada and Skrillex.
